A registered agent is an assigned individual or service entity in charge of receiving essential legal and official papers in support of a company or company. This role is a critical component of a company's legal and conformity structure, making certain that notices such as solution of process, government document, and conformity filings are correctly gotten and handled in a timely fashion. The registered agent works as the point of call between the state and the company, giving a reliable address where lawful records can be offered during typical organization hours. Numerous territories need that a business keep a registered agent as part of its development and recurring conformity commitments. Picking the appropriate registered agent can considerably impact a firm's ability to respond swiftly to lawful notifications and prevent penalties or default judgments. The agent's address need to be a physical place within the state of formation or procedure, not a P.O. box, which stresses the value of a relied on, easily accessible visibility within the jurisdiction. Some business decide to work as their own registered agent, while others hire professional registered agent services to guarantee compliance and discretion. Specialist signed up agents often offer fringe benefits such as file forwarding, conformity notifies, and protected handling of sensitive information, making them a popular selection for busy business owners and corporations.
